Abstract
This paper discusses the various techniques used to protect a satellite communication terminal against intentional electromagnetic interference. The SATCOM terminal employ miniaturised active and logic devices which can withstand energy up to 10-6 joules only. However, the energy density released by nuclear/non nuclear sources is reported to be 0.4 joules at the boundary of deposition region and is capable to upset or damage the communication terminal. Efforts have been made to incorporate all possible protection mechanism so that the communication terminal remains unaffected under worst scenario.
